Lines Matching refs:Qdisc

25 	struct Qdisc **queues;
29 static struct Qdisc *
30 multiq_classify(struct sk_buff *skb, struct Qdisc *sch, int *qerr)
60 multiq_enqueue(struct sk_buff *skb, struct Qdisc *sch,
63 struct Qdisc *qdisc;
87 static struct sk_buff *multiq_dequeue(struct Qdisc *sch)
90 struct Qdisc *qdisc;
118 static struct sk_buff *multiq_peek(struct Qdisc *sch)
122 struct Qdisc *qdisc;
148 multiq_reset(struct Qdisc *sch)
159 multiq_destroy(struct Qdisc *sch)
171 static int multiq_tune(struct Qdisc *sch, struct nlattr *opt,
176 struct Qdisc **removed;
197 struct Qdisc *child = q->queues[i];
213 struct Qdisc *child, *old;
235 static int multiq_init(struct Qdisc *sch, struct nlattr *opt,
252 q->queues = kcalloc(q->max_bands, sizeof(struct Qdisc *), GFP_KERNEL);
261 static int multiq_dump(struct Qdisc *sch, struct sk_buff *skb)
280 static int multiq_graft(struct Qdisc *sch, unsigned long arg, struct Qdisc *new,
281 struct Qdisc **old, struct netlink_ext_ack *extack)
293 static struct Qdisc *
294 multiq_leaf(struct Qdisc *sch, unsigned long arg)
302 static unsigned long multiq_find(struct Qdisc *sch, u32 classid)
312 static unsigned long multiq_bind(struct Qdisc *sch, unsigned long parent,
319 static void multiq_unbind(struct Qdisc *q, unsigned long cl)
323 static int multiq_dump_class(struct Qdisc *sch, unsigned long cl,
333 static int multiq_dump_class_stats(struct Qdisc *sch, unsigned long cl,
337 struct Qdisc *cl_q;
347 static void multiq_walk(struct Qdisc *sch, struct qdisc_walker *arg)
361 static struct tcf_block *multiq_tcf_block(struct Qdisc *sch, unsigned long cl,